This book is the third volume in the CIRP Novel Topics in Production Engineering (CNTPE), a collection of essays addressing novel research areas in production engineering, published regularly in book volumes. Each essay provides a systematization and explanation of a technology, an approach, a process, etc., and covers a novel research area once it has been published in the scientific literature for a few years. The essays provide focused and structured knowledge of a defined and limited subject in terms of detailed implementation, a systematic description of theoretical hypotheses and results, constructive and design characteristics for a product/process or experiment, and exemplary applications to real cases. These constitute the background knowledge for scientists/professionals to approach a novel scientific and technological area—addressing background concepts, relevant tools and methodologies, language, and theory.

Part 1: STC C – Cutting.- Engineered cutting processes for additively manufactured metallic components.- Part 2: STC F – Forming.- Perspectives on machine learning for metal forming research and implementation.- Part 3: STC G – Abrasive processes.- Ultra-precision conformal polishing of microstructured surfaces by tool-driven shear thickening polishing: Mechanisms, modeling and case studies.- Advanced integration of sensor technology for increasing efficiency in gear grinding.- Part 4: STC M – Machines.- 5G technology in production: State, applications and trends.- Energy-saving measures for machine tools: From measurement insights to practical implementation.- Part 5: STC P – Precision engineering and metrology.- Large machine tool calibration: Shifting towards fast, integrated, cost-attractive and low complexity solutions.
